Hi, I'm the manager of this site, my
name is Joe, but you can call me "Pappy_Joe"  I was born
in Gadsden, Alabama before the 1950's and grew up there, in the 50's and 60's.   As I grew up, my family consisted of 8 children, and I never was able to own a bb gun, so I had to borrow the bb guns, I shot. 
 
 I spent 20 years in the United States Marine Corps, and
retired in 1990.  I then moved back to my hometown
(Gadsden, Alabama), where I still live.  I started buying
Daisys BB Guns in 1990, but it took me a few years to realize that I was collecting them. 
 
My childhood friend got me started in collecting em, he
had quite a few BB Guns when we were growing up.  He
enjoyed hunting for the older ones as an adult child. 
We became partners and together we would storm the
Trade Days, Yard Sales, Junk Stores, Antique Stores,
Hardware Stores, Wal-Mart, K-Mart, and any-where
else we could think of, and buy any and all Daisy guns
we could find. 
 
In 1995 I started selling most of my collection off, at 
that time I had 147 guns.  Most of these guns were in very
good to excellent condition, with a large number in mint
still in the box.  My wife warned me against selling my
collection, but I went against her advise anyway and began
selling em.  After selling most of my collection, I realized,
that I really missed em. 
 
In fact I missed my Daisy Collection, so bad, I had
to start collecting again in 2000.  That was when my wife
got me a computer for Christmas and I discovered there
were a large number of Daisy collector out here on the web.
  
Right now I have over 200 Daisy Guns (which fills one
room in our home).  I started a community web site on
collecting air guns to help other collectors and to exchange
information.  I hope you get enjoyment and some
information from this site.   I started in 2001, with
(VintageAirBBToyGuns), and changed the name
to (AIR GUNS USA), in September, 2002.  I would like to
